The EU is considering classifying ethanol as a hazardous substance and banning its use in hand sanitizers.
(Brussels) The European Union is considering classifying ethanol, the main active ingredient in alcohol-based hand sanitizers, as a dangerous substance that increases the risk of cancer. If implemented, this move would effectively ban many hand sanitizers and cleaning agents commonly used in hospitals.

British troops will be able to shoot down drones flying over military bases
(London Comprehensive News) Britain's armed forces will be given new powers to shoot down unidentified drones flying over military bases in response to the growing threat from Russia.
